How make a career in Real Estate Lease Administrator

A career as a Real Estate Lease Administrator offers a unique opportunity to manage and oversee lease agreements for properties, ensuring compliance and optimizing leasing processes. To embark on this career path, individuals typically need a strong academic background in real estate, business administration, or a related field. Pursuing a bachelor's degree is essential, followed by potential specialization through certifications in property management or real estate law. Gaining practical experience through internships or entry-level positions in property management firms enhances employability. Networking with professionals in the real estate sector and staying updated with the latest market trends and legal regulations are also crucial. With a blend of education, experience, and a passion for real estate, one can build a rewarding career dedicated to managing lease agreements effectively.

What are the roles and responsibilities in Real Estate Lease Administrator?

  • Managing Lease Agreements : Real Estate Lease Administrators oversee the preparation, negotiation, and execution of lease agreements, ensuring compliance with legal standards.
  • Tenant Relations : They act as a liaison between tenants and property owners, addressing concerns and facilitating communication to maintain positive relationships.
  • Data Management : They maintain accurate records of lease agreements, renewals, and amendments, ensuring all documentation is up to date.
  • Market Analysis : Real Estate Lease Administrators analyze market trends to advise on rental pricing and lease terms that align with current market conditions.
  • Compliance Monitoring : They ensure compliance with local, state, and federal regulations related to leasing and property management.

What are the key skills required for Real Estate Lease Administrator

  • Negotiation Skills - These skills are crucial for negotiating lease terms and conditions that are favorable for both tenants and property owners.
  • Attention to Detail - Meticulous attention to detail is vital for managing lease documentation and ensuring compliance with regulations.
  • Organizational Skills - The ability to manage multiple leases and deadlines effectively is essential for success in this role.
  • Communication Skills - Effective communication is important for building relationships with tenants and property owners.
  • Analytical Skills - The ability to analyze market trends and financial data is key to making informed leasing decisions.

What is the salary and demand for Real Estate Lease Administrator?

  • Salary Overview - The typical salary for Real Estate Lease Administrators ranges from $45,000 for entry-level positions to over $80,000 for experienced professionals, with variations based on education and location.
  • Regional Salary Variations - Salaries can vary significantly by region; for example, Lease Administrators in metropolitan areas may earn more than those in smaller towns.
  • Current Job Market Demand - The demand for Real Estate Lease Administrators is growing due to increasing real estate transactions and the need for effective lease management.
  • Future Demand Projections - Future demand for Real Estate Lease Administrators is expected to rise as the real estate market continues to expand and evolve.

Pros & Cons of a Career in Real Estate Lease Administrator

Pros

  • Real Estate Lease Administrators play a crucial role in managing significant assets, making their work impactful and rewarding.
  • The field offers competitive salaries, especially for those with advanced qualifications and experience.
  • Professionals in this field contribute to the efficient use of properties, enhancing community value and economic growth.
  • The career provides opportunities for continuous learning and advancement in a dynamic real estate market.

Cons

  • The job can be demanding with long hours, especially during peak leasing seasons or when managing multiple properties.
  • Some roles may require extensive travel to properties, which can be physically taxing.
  • Market fluctuations can lead to job instability or uncertainty in the real estate sector.
  • The work can sometimes be isolating, especially for those engaged in extensive administrative tasks away from team environments.
